The Ultimate Guide to Calisthenics Parks near The Woodlands
The Woodlands, with its extensive network of parks and green spaces, offers some of the best outdoor calisthenics and bodyweight training opportunities in the greater Houston area. Training in these parks provides a refreshing change of scenery from a traditional gym and allows you to build strength and endurance in a natural environment.
Here is the ultimate guide to the top calisthenics parks near The Woodlands.
- The Woodlands’ Main Parks
These parks are located directly in The Woodlands and are perfect for a full-body calisthenics workout.
Bear Branch Park:
Equipment: This park features a well-equipped fitness area with a variety of stations. You’ll find a series of pull-up bars at different heights, parallel bars for dips and L-sits, and monkey bars for building grip strength and upper body endurance.
Vibe: The park has a highly active and family-friendly atmosphere. It’s often used by runners, cyclists, and other fitness enthusiasts, making it a great place to meet people who share your passion for fitness.
Northshore Park:
Equipment: The park has a dedicated fitness trail with several exercise stations that are well-suited for calisthenics. You’ll find pull-up bars , sit-up benches , and various other bodyweight training apparatus.
Vibe: This park is a beautiful spot with views of Lake Woodlands. It’s perfect for a relaxing morning or afternoon workout. The open grassy areas are also great for dynamic stretching and floor-based movements.
- Parks in Nearby Houston Area
For those willing to drive a bit south, these Houston parks offer some of the best calisthenics setups in the city.
Memorial Park (Houston):
Equipment: While a drive from The Woodlands, Memorial Park is often considered the gold standard for outdoor calisthenics in Houston. It has a massive, modern rig with multiple pull-up bars , dip bars , and a huge open area for floor work.
Vibe: The park is a hub for athletes and fitness enthusiasts. The atmosphere is energetic and motivating, with people of all ages and fitness levels training together.
Hermann Park (Houston):
Equipment: Hermann Park has a well-equipped fitness zone with a variety of stations, including pull-up bars and parallel bars .
Vibe: The park has a more relaxed and beautiful atmosphere. It’s a great spot for a workout followed by a walk around the park’s scenic grounds.
Tips for Training in Calisthenics Parks
To get the most out of your workout, keep these tips in mind, especially when training in the Houston climate.
Stay Hydrated: Houston’s heat and humidity can be intense. Always bring a large water bottle and stay hydrated throughout your workout.
Go with a Partner: Training with a friend is a great way to stay motivated and to have someone to spot you on more difficult exercises.
Bring Your Own Gear: While the parks have excellent equipment, bringing your own resistance bands , gymnastic rings , or parallettes can add variety and challenge to your workout.
Listen to Your Body: The sun can be an added challenge. Be sure to warm up properly and to listen to your body, especially on hot days.
